Casual Conversion. 17.4.1 A casual employee who has been engaged for a period of six (6) months or more will be entitled to elect to convert to daily hire employment. 17.4.2 Where a casual employee elects to convert their employment to daily hire in accordance with Clause 17.4.1, conversion to daily hire will be offered as either full-time employment (i.e. a full- time daily hire employee is engaged and paid for thirty-six (36) hours per week) or part – time (on the basis of the hours the casual employee regularly worked). 17.4.3 A casual employee who has the right to elect to convert their employment in accordance with Clause 17.4.1 will give four (4) weeks’ notice in writing to the employer. 17.4.4 Where the employer receives notice of the right to elect in accordance with Clause 17.4.1, the 17.4.4(a) respond to the employee’s notice within four (4) weeks of receiving the notice;
